This design project is an Electric Vehicle for people to commute within Cyberjaya City. Most significantly,<br />

Cyberjaya community is facing inefficient public transport services. It is also difficult to walk from one place to<br />

another, due to the building’s location and distance. The lack of shades and cool environment would sometimes<br />

makes the Cyberjaya City too humid and does not permit people to walk from one location to another.<br />

We study the characteristics of Pickands’ dependence function for bivariate extreme distribution for minima,<br />

BEVM, when considering the stochastics ordering of the two variables, X < Y. The existing Pickand’s dependence<br />

function terminologies and theories are modified to suit the dependence functions of extreme minimum cases. The<br />

main result is the introduction of the restricted logistic dependence function, ARL and the restricted exponential<br />

function, VRL(x, y).
